1956 was when he appeared as Moses in The Ten Commandments and became a huge celebrity. but 1959-'66 was an astonishing run:

1959: Ben-Hur, in which he starred as Ben-Hur

1961: El Cid, another massive 3+ hour historical epic where he starred as El Cid

1963: 55 Days in Peking, the epic film about the siege of foreigners in Beijing during the Boxer rebellion

1965: The Agony and the Ecstasy (starring as Michelangelo as he fights with Pope Julius II over the Sistine Chapel's interior design)

Major Dundee, a violent early Sam Peckinpah western film about a US military raid into Mexico during the civil war

The War Lord, where he starred as a knight who faces a rebellion in northern France

1966: Khartoum, where he plays a doomed military commander during the Siege of Khartoum

he also appeared as John the Baptist in 'The Greatest Story Ever Told' in 1965, though it wasn't the starring role of that film.
